Transaction 58188a421a1441d7d0cc032ab2614e8c19ed71dd9b55d6a8ee96a6190781707a
1 Input
1 Output
-
58188a421a1441d7d0cc032ab2614e8c19ed71dd9b55d6a8ee96a6190781707a:0
- value
- 1399335
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c2703c17e28c6a95053d6e27af61eb7818128e9 OP_EQUAL
- address
- 38dg1uidqaYKe254UCMg4tRsmD3Yi51VEo